David did a lot of charity performances over the past year for mental health, refugees, support of artists and other organizations, but the main focus of our involvement became The Buttery, near Byron Bay, New South Wale.  This is a therapeutic community for those willing to deal with their drug and alcohol problems and the work The Buttery does is quite outstanding.  It is an 8 month course and those who see the course to the end have an 83 percent recovery rate. This is a truly remarkable result. We became Patrons in March and this year will see our efforts go to the Building Appeal so the community can be doubled in size.  Needless to say, the demand for places is huge.

On 26th November 2006 David received another honour by being inducted into The Australian Walk of Fame at the Gold Coast in Queensland.  His star will soon be on the walkway with his handprints and he was very thrilled to be acknowledged in this way.
